Output 40623bcea77683815aeb6aedf59111f59524b1709a8e5ad86d18f0f4200c4174:1
- value
- 34057368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4068250a116e7398f9e0acf0b1405e58115b31ac OP_EQUAL
- address
- 37ZZvvLh5t76XSXipbuksiw1wKLCEWhqmW
- transaction
- 40623bcea77683815aeb6aedf59111f59524b1709a8e5ad86d18f0f4200c4174